Where is vlogger James Stauffer now, who controversially rehomed his son?
A new HBO docuseries has thrown controversial YouTubers Myka and James Stauffer back into the spotlight.
Released on January 15, the three-part documentary series titled An Update on Our Family follows the story of how the vlogger parents adopted an autistic child from China only to reveal later that they had 'rehomed' him in 2020. They had adopted him when he was two and a half years old in 2017.
Myka and James said that the toddler's needs had been greater than they had anticipated.
'For us, it's been really hard hearing from the medical professionals, a lot of their feedback, and things that have been upsetting,' James said in a May 2020 video. 'We've never wanted to be in this position. And we've been trying to get his needs met and help him out as much as possible ... we truly love him.' Myka Stauffer and James Stauffer were accused by netizens of adopting a child for the wrong reasons. Photo: @mykastauffer/Instagram
The video drew plenty of backlash, with many netizens accusing the couple of adopting the child for financial or business related reasons, and for not taking on the responsibility required when adopting a child.
